📊 R36S vs MIYOO Mini Plus: Side-by-Side Specs
| Specification | R36S | MIYOO Mini Plus |
|---|---|---|
| Price | $79.99 | ~$69 |
| Screen | 3.5" IPS | 3.5" IPS |
| Resolution | 640×480 | 640×480 |
| Processor | Allwinner H700 | Ingenic T618 |
| RAM | 1GB DDR3 | 256MB DDR3 |
| Battery | 3,200mAh | 3,000mAh |
| Battery Life | 6–8 hrs | 5–7 hrs |
| Storage | 64GB / 128GB | Varies (SD card) |
| WiFi | Dongle only | ✅ Built-in |
| Form Factor | Horizontal | Horizontal (smaller) |
| Preloaded Games | ✅ Thousands | ❌ Bring your own |
| iGC Rating | ⭐ 4.70/5 (2,837) | ⭐ 4.6/5 (community) |
📺 Screen & Display
Both devices feature a 3.5" IPS panel at 640×480 resolution — on paper, identical. In practice:
- R36S: Bright, vibrant colors. Excellent viewing angles. The screen feels larger due to the device's horizontal layout and thinner bezels on the gaming area.
- MIYOO Mini Plus: Equally sharp IPS panel. Slightly warmer color temperature. The smaller body makes the screen feel more compact despite identical specs.
iGC verdict: Screen quality is essentially equal. The R36S feels more immersive due to its larger overall form factor.
⚡ Performance & Game Compatibility
This is where the two devices diverge most significantly. The R36S has 4x more RAM (1GB vs 256MB), which matters for demanding emulation:
| Platform | R36S | MIYOO Mini Plus |
|---|---|---|
| NES / SNES / GBA |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 |
| Game Boy / GBC |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 |
| PlayStation 1 |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| ⭐⭐⭐⭐ |
| Nintendo 64 | ⭐⭐⭐⭐ | ⭐⭐⭐ |
| PSP | ⭐⭐⭐ | ❌ Not supported |
| Sega Genesis |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 |
Critical difference: The MIYOO Mini Plus cannot run PSP games. If PSP is on your list, the R36S is the only choice between these two.

💻 Software & OS: The Biggest Hidden Difference
This is the most underrated difference between the two devices:
- R36S (ArkOS / EmuELEC): Ships with thousands of preloaded games. Plug in and play immediately. No setup required. ArkOS firmware is mature and well-supported. Ideal for beginners and gift buyers.
- MIYOO Mini Plus (OnionOS): Ships without preloaded games — you bring your own ROMs. OnionOS is arguably the most polished custom firmware in the retro handheld space. Built-in WiFi enables scraping, online features, and remote ROM loading. Ideal for enthusiasts who want full control.
